Asphalt 8: Airborne – A Comprehensive Overview 2025

Asphalt 8: Airborne, developed by Gameloft, has become a cornerstone in the mobile gaming world since its release in August 2013. With its stunning graphics, dynamic gameplay, and an expansive roster of cars and tracks, it has captivated millions of players across the globe. This article delves into the features, gameplay mechanics, and the impact of Asphalt 8 in the racing game genre.

The Essence of Asphalt 8

Asphalt 8: Airborne is part of the renowned Asphalt series, known for its high-octane racing action and arcade-style gameplay. Unlike traditional racing simulations that focus on realism, Asphalt 8 embraces an exaggerated approach, allowing players to perform jaw-dropping stunts and speed through beautifully rendered environments. The game’s unique blend of arcade action and simulation elements creates an exhilarating experience that appeals to both casual and hardcore gamers.

Diverse Game Modes

Asphalt 8 offers a variety of game modes that cater to different player preferences.

  1. Career Mode: This is the heart of Asphalt 8, featuring a series of events where players can unlock new cars, upgrades, and earn rewards. The career mode is structured into multiple seasons, each consisting of various races that challenge players to improve their skills and strategies.
  2. Multiplayer Mode: For those looking to compete against real players, Asphalt 8 provides an engaging multiplayer experience. Players can join live races or compete asynchronously against friends or global competitors. This mode introduces a layer of excitement and competitiveness, as players can compare their skills and rankings on global leaderboards.
  3. Events and Challenges: Regularly updated events and challenges keep the gameplay fresh. These time-limited competitions often feature unique rules and objectives, offering players the chance to earn exclusive rewards and cars. Seasonal events aligned with real-world happenings also keep players engaged throughout the year.
  4. Custom Events: Players can create their own racing challenges, allowing for a personalized gaming experience. This feature enhances the replayability of the game, as players can share their custom events with friends and the wider community.

Dynamic Gameplay Mechanics

Asphalt 8 is celebrated for its dynamic and fast-paced gameplay. The controls are designed to be intuitive, with options for tilt steering or touch controls, ensuring accessibility for players of all skill levels.

Nitro Boost: One of the signature features of Asphalt 8 is the nitro boost system. Players can earn nitro by performing stunts, drifting, and speeding, adding an exhilarating layer to the racing experience. Timing the use of nitro becomes crucial, especially in competitive races, as it can make the difference between victory and defeat.

Airborne Mechanics: The game’s title, “Airborne,” reflects the ability to perform aerial maneuvers. Players can jump off ramps, perform flips and spins in mid-air, and land with precision to maintain speed. Mastering these airborne techniques is essential for gaining an edge over opponents and achieving faster lap times.

Drifting: Drifting is another key mechanic that allows players to navigate tight corners while maintaining speed. Successfully executing drifts can also contribute to nitro buildup, encouraging players to hone their skills and become proficient in managing turns.

Extensive Car Collection

Asphalt 8 boasts a vast collection of cars, with over 300 licensed vehicles available to players. Each car belongs to a specific class, ranging from A to S, reflecting their performance capabilities. Players can customize their vehicles with upgrades, enhancing speed, handling, and nitro efficiency.

The thrill of collecting and upgrading cars is a significant aspect of the game. Players can earn in-game currency through races, allowing them to purchase new vehicles or upgrade existing ones. The variety of cars caters to different playstyles, ensuring that every player can find a vehicle that suits their preferences.

In-Game Currency and Monetization

Asphalt 8 employs a freemium model, allowing players to download and play the game for free while offering in-app purchases. Players can purchase in-game currency, known as “Tokens” and “Coins,” to speed up progress, unlock cars, or acquire upgrades. While players can enjoy the game without spending money, those who choose to invest can progress more quickly and access premium content.

The monetization strategy has garnered mixed reviews. While some players appreciate the option to enhance their experience through purchases, others feel that it can create an uneven playing field, especially in multiplayer mode. However, the game has made strides to balance competitive play, ensuring that skill remains a crucial factor in winning races.
